3 = Obsolete methods that are depriciated
5 If you really want to see them, go to lib/tmail/obsolete.rb and view to your
10 # Copyright (c) 1998-2003 Minero Aoki <aamine@loveruby.net>
12 # Permission is hereby granted, free of charge, to any person obtaining
13 # a copy of this software and associated documentation files (the
14 # "Software"), to deal in the Software without restriction, including
15 # without limitation the rights to use, copy, modify, merge, publish,
16 # distribute, sublicense, and/or sell copies of the Software, and to
17 # permit persons to whom the Software is furnished to do so, subject to
18 # the following conditions:
20 # The above copyright notice and this permission notice shall be
21 # included in all copies or substantial portions of the Software.
23 # TH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ND,
24 # E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F
25 # M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ND
26 # N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E
27 # L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ION
28 # O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ION
29 # W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.
31 # Note: Originally licensed under LGPL v2+. Using MIT license for Rails
32 # with permission of Minero Aoki.
43 each_field
{|v
| ret
.push v
}
48 HeaderField
=== val
or return false
50 [ @header[val
.name
.downcase
] ].flatten
.include? val
53 alias has_value
? value
?
57 def from_addr( default
= nil )
58 addr
, = from_addrs(nil)
62 def from_address( default
= nil )
70 alias from_address
= from_addrs
=
72 def from_phrase( default
= nil )
80 alias msgid message_id
81 alias msgid
= message_id
=
83 alias each_dest each_destination
91 @local, @domain = str
.split(/@/,2).map
{|s
| s
.split(/\./) }
99 alias new_mail new_port
100 alias each_mail each_port
101 alias each_newmail each_new_port
104 alias new_mail new_port
105 alias each_mail each_port
106 alias each_newmail each_new_port
109 alias new_mail new_port
110 alias each_mail each_port
111 alias each_newmail each_new_port
117 alias msgid
? message_id
?
118 alias boundary new_boundary
119 alias msgid new_message_id
120 alias new_msgid new_message_id
128 ::TMail.new_message_id